Three superb goals from Joyson, Princston and Standly sufficed to silence Salgaocar and give Sporting Clube a smooth passage into the finals of the GFA U-18 tournament.
In the first semi-finals played at Duler Stadium today both teams  matched each other for the first ten minutes before  Joyson sent a left footer from the top of the box out of reach of Salgaocar keeper Vialli into the back of the nets, after he was fed  by Trijoy, following a move initiated by Osbern, to  give Sporting the 
coveted lead (1-0).
The first session ended with  Sporting holding on to their 1-0 lead and  with both teams engaging in mid-field skirmishes without really testing the rival keepers.
Sporting started the second session with a bang scoring twice in the first ten minutes.  Sporting skipper Princeton consolidated the lead in the 51st minute showcasing his talent by creating space at the top of the Salgaocar box and bending a  right footer  into the top corner of the goal past a hapless Vialli (2-0).
A few minutes later it was the turn of striker Standly to make the issue really sfe for Sporting,  as he latched onto a perfect defense splitting aerial ball  from Princeton, to find the nets with a deft placement (3-0).
Salgaocar did not give up the fight lying down and came at their rival with all guns blazing with their midfieild trio of Kaushik, Josbon and Chaitan holding possession and feeding their upfront players.  
But all their moves fizzled out on top of the Sporting box where Casel and Danish stood out with their timely tackles and positional play.
Sporting now await the winners of the semi-finals between Churchill Brothers and Sesa  Academy to be played on May 22 at Duler Stadium.  The finals are slated for May 27 at Duler.    
Scorebox: Sporting Clube   3 beat Salgaocar 0
